
它不仅广泛应用于各类网站和应用程序中,还成为了开源软件运动的标志性成就之一
那么,MySQL究竟是谁写的?它的诞生背景、发展历程以及背后的开发者们如何影响了整个数据库行业?本文将深入探讨这些问题,带您领略MySQL的非凡历程
MySQL的起源:从瑞典到全球 MySQL的故事始于20世纪90年代中期的瑞典
当时,Michael “Monty” Widenius(蒙提·维德尼乌斯)和David Axmark(大卫·阿克马克)两位程序员,为了管理他们自己的网站,开始着手开发一个简单、高效的数据库管理系统
他们的初衷是创建一个易于使用、性能卓越且能够处理大量数据的数据库系统
在开发初期,MySQL还只是一个内部工具,用于满足他们自己的需求
然而,随着功能的不断完善和性能的持续提升,MySQL逐渐吸引了外界的注意
1996年,MySQL的第一个公开版本正式发布,这标志着它正式踏上了成为全球领先数据库系统的征程
核心开发者团队:智慧与汗水的结晶 MySQL的成功,离不开其核心开发者团队的共同努力
除了蒙提和大卫之外,另一位关键人物是Allan Larsson(阿兰·拉森),他在MySQL的早期开发中扮演了重要角色
这三位开发者被誉为MySQL的“三驾马车”,他们的智慧和汗水共同铸就了MySQL的辉煌
在开发过程中,他们面临了诸多挑战
如何在保证性能的同时,提供易于使用的界面?如何确保数据库系统的稳定性和安全性?这些问题都需要他们不断摸索和实践
通过无数次的迭代和优化,MySQL逐渐形成了自己独特的优势:高性能、易用性、可扩展性和开放性
值得一提的是,MySQL从一开始就采用了开源的商业模式,这使得它能够迅速吸引大量开发者和用户的关注
开源不仅降低了用户的使用成本,还促进了MySQL技术的快速传播和创新
开源社区的崛起:众志成城的力量 随着MySQL的知名度日益提高,越来越多的开发者开始加入到这个开源项目中来
他们来自世界各地,拥有不同的背景和专长,但共同的目标是将MySQL打造成为更加优秀、更加完善的数据库系统
开源社区的崛起,为MySQL的发展注入了强大的动力
开发者们通过在线论坛、邮件列表、代码仓库等渠道,积极交流心得、分享经验、贡献代码
这种众志成城的力量,使得MySQL的功能不断丰富、性能不断提升、稳定性不断增强
同时,开源社区还促进了MySQL技术的普及和应用
越来越多的企业和个人开始使用MySQL来构建自己的网站和应用程序
这不仅扩大了MySQL的市场份额,还为其带来了更加广泛的应用场景和更加多元化的用户需求
商业公司的转型:从开源到盈利 随着MySQL的广泛应用和开源社区的蓬勃发展,蒙提和大卫等人意识到,将MySQL打造成为一个商业公司的时机已经成熟
于是,在2001年,他们成立了MySQL AB公司,专注于MySQL产品的研发、推广和支持服务
MySQL AB公司的成立,标志着MySQL从开源项目向商业公司的转型
通过提供专业的技术支持、培训服务、定制化开发等增值服务,MySQL AB公司实现了从开源到盈利的跨越
同时,公司还积极与各大软硬件厂商合作,推动MySQL技术在更广泛的领域得到应用
然而,商业公司的转型并非一帆风顺
在快速发展的过程中,MySQL AB公司也面临着诸多挑战:如何平衡开源社区的利益和商业公司的盈利需求?如何保持MySQL技术的领先地位和创新能力?这些问题都需要他们不断思考和探索
被收购与后续发展:传承与创新并重 2008年,MySQL AB公司被全球领先的数据库巨头Sun Microsystems(太阳微系统公司)收购
这次收购不仅为MySQL带来了更加雄厚的资金支持和更加广阔的市场前景,还使其融入了Sun Microsystems的庞大技术生态体系中
然而,好景不长
2010年,随着Sun Microsystems被甲骨文公司(Oracle Corporation)收购,MySQL的命运再次发生了转折
面对新的东家和更加激烈的市场竞争环境,MySQL团队需要更加努力地保持其独立性和创新性
在甲骨文的领导下,MySQL继续保持着开源的传统和开放的态度
同时,团队还不断推出新的功能和优化措施,以满足日益多样化的用户需求
例如,MySQL5.7和MySQL8.0等版本的发布,都带来了显著的性能提升和易用性改进
此外,MySQL还积极与其他开源项目和社区进行合作,共同推动数据库技术的创新和发展
这种传承与创新并重的策略,使得MySQL在激烈的市场竞争中始终保持着自己的独特优势和领先地位
结语:MySQL的非凡历程与深远影响 回顾MySQL的非凡历程,我们不禁为那些默默耕耘的开发者们所感动
正是他们的智慧和汗水,共同铸就了MySQL这一开源软件的瑰宝
从瑞典到全球、从开源项目到商业公司、从被收购到持续发展,MySQL的每一步都凝聚着无数人的心血和汗水
如今,MySQL已经成为全球领先的数据库管理系统之一,广泛应用于各类网站和应用程序中
它不仅为用户提供了高效、稳定、易用的数据库解决方案,还推动了开源软件运动的发展和数据库技术的创新
可以说,MySQL的成就和影响已经远远超出了其自身的范畴,成为了整个数据库行业乃至整个信息技术领域的重要里程碑
展望未来,我们有理由相信,在开源社区的共同努力下,MySQL将继续保持着其领先地位和创新能力
它将不断推出新的功能和优化措施,以满足日益多样化的用户需求;它将积极与其他开源项目和社区进行合作,共同推动数据库技术的创新和发展;它还将继续秉承着开源的精神和开放的态度,为更多的用户和企业带来更加优质、更加便捷的数据库服务
让我们共同期待MySQL更加美好的未来!
乐观锁机制:提升MySQL并发性能的利器
揭秘:MySQL究竟是谁写的?
一键操作:轻松修改MySQL数据库保存路径
MySQL插入操作缓慢:原因与对策
MySQL服务器CPU占用过高解析
MySQL实战:轻松导入外部数据教程
Akonadi-MySQL:高效数据管理的新选择
乐观锁机制:提升MySQL并发性能的利器
一键操作:轻松修改MySQL数据库保存路径
MySQL插入操作缓慢:原因与对策
MySQL服务器CPU占用过高解析
MySQL实战:轻松导入外部数据教程
Akonadi-MySQL:高效数据管理的新选择
轻松学会:如何编写高效的MySQL函数?
MySQL成绩排序技巧总结概览
Django与MySQL实战:打造高效Web项目案例
PGSQL与MySQL连接数优化指南
一键操作:轻松扩大MySQL表单长度的秘诀
掌握MySQL:社区数据库访问语言的精髓